The weight of each bag is 0.545 lb .
<h3>What is weight ?</h3>
Weight in maths is the value of the mass of an object on a measuring scale , It is measured in pound , ounce , kilogram etc.
It is given that
Total weight of green grapes = 5.65 lb
Total weight of red grapes = 3.07lb
Total weight = 5.65 +3.07 = 8.72 lb
Total number of bags = 16
the weight of each bag
= 8.72 / 16
= 0.545 lb
Therefore the weight of each bag is 0.545 lb .
The complete question is
Emilio bought 5.65lb of green grapes and 3.07lb of red grapes. He divided the grapes equally into 16 bags. If each bag of grapes has the same weight, how much does each bag weigh?
